I love my long hair.

I’ve been growing it for at least 7 years now.

I don’t dye it or use heat that often, I cut the ends 1-2 inches every 6 months, at night I put it in a bun and sleep with a silk pillow case.

... Read moreLong hair can be beautiful and healthy with the right care. Many people often wonder how to grow and maintain their hair effectively. The first step is to establish a consistent routine that includes regular trims, ideally every 6-8 weeks, to get rid of split ends and promote growth. Additionally, incorporating gentle hair care products is essential to prevent damage. Sleeping on a silk pillowcase can significantly benefit your hair by reducing friction and moisture loss overnight. Moreover, using hair ties that won’t cause breakage or stress on the hair shaft is crucial. Natural oils, such as argan oil or jojoba oil, can also help in keeping hair nourished and shiny. Hydration from within is vital, so drinking plenty of water is often overlooked but essential for hair health.
